In the world of personal financing, a handful of names are as widely known and prominent as Robert Kiyosaki. Best recognized for his successful book “Rich Dad, Poor Dad,” Kiyosaki has actually created a profession out of coaching people how to achieve monetary abundance and break free from the old-fashioned “rat race” of working for an income.

At the core of Kiyosaki’s philosophy is the concept that real financial freedom comes not from earning a high income, but from building wealth through wise financial investments and producing passive earnings streams. According to Kiyosaki, the secret to accomplishing monetary abundance is to switch your focus from working for money to having your cash work for you.

One of the main principles in Kiyosaki’s teachings is the concept of “cash flow.” This refers to the quantity of money coming in each month from financial investments, rental properties, and other sources of passive earnings, minus the volume of cash being spent every month in costs. According to Kiyosaki, the secret to achieving monetary flexibility is to increase your cash flow to the point where it surpasses your costs.

Another crucial element of Kiyosaki’s viewpoint is the idea of “monetary intelligence.” This describes the ability to comprehend and make clever decisions about cash, including purchasing assets that will generate passive income. Kiyosaki argues that monetary intelligence is just as important as standard intelligence when it comes to attaining monetary success.

One of the most controversial elements of Kiyosaki’s viewpoint is his criticism of traditional education and the method it teaches us to think of money. According to Kiyosaki, the conventional education system is tailored towards producing good staff members, not rich entrepreneurs. He argues that the conventional education system teaches us to be dependent on a paycheck, instead of teaching us how to create our own earnings streams through investments and entrepreneurship.

Among the most essential actions to financial abundance, according to Kiyosaki, is taking control of your own monetary education. This suggests learning how to purchase properties that will generate passive earnings, such as rental homes, stocks, and bonds. It likewise means learning how to manage your money effectively and stay clear of financial mistakes such as high-interest financial debt.

Another important element of Kiyosaki’s viewpoint is the concept of “financial freedom.” This describes the capability to live life on your own terms, without being restricted by the need to work for an income. According to Kiyosaki, monetary freedom is the ultimate goal of personal financing, and it can just be accomplished by building wealth through clever investments and establishing several streams of passive earnings.
